Athom Smart Plug PG03-US16A

Athom Smart Plug PG03-US16A

Device Type: plug
Electrical Standard: us
Board: esp8266

alt text Manufacturer: https://www.athom.tech/ (discontinued. New version: PG03V2-US16A) Available with Tasmota pre-flashed.

Pinout information thanks to

Sensor constants and reference ESPHome configuration from

GPIO Pinout

PinFunction
GPIO3Button
GPIO4BL0937 CF
GPIO5HLWBL CF1
GPIO12HLWBL SELi
GPIO13Blue LED
GPIO14Relay

Basic Configuration

substitutions:
name: "athom-smart-plug"
friendly_name: "Athom Smart Plug"
relay_restore_mode: RESTORE_DEFAULT_OFF
esphome:
name: "${name}"
name_add_mac_suffix: true
esp8266:
board: esp8285
restore_from_flash: true
preferences:
flash_write_interval: 1min
# Enable Home Assistant API
api:
ota:
# Enable logging
logger:
web_server:
port: 80
wifi:
ssid: "ssid"
password: "password"
# Enable fallback hotspot (captive portal) in case wifi connection fails
ap:
ssid: "${friendly_name} Hotspot"
password: ""
captive_portal:
# Time used for daily KWh usage
time:
- platform: homeassistant
id: homeassistant_time
binary_sensor:
- platform: status
name: "${friendly_name} Status"
- platform: gpio
pin:
number: GPIO3
mode: INPUT_PULLUP
inverted: true
name: "${friendly_name} Power Button"
disabled_by_default: true
on_multi_click:
- timing:
- ON for at most 1s
- OFF for at least 0.2s
then:
- switch.toggle: relay
- timing:
- ON for at least 4s
then:
- button.press: Reset
sensor:
- platform: uptime
name: "${friendly_name} Uptime"
icon: mdi:clock-outline
disabled_by_default: true
- platform: hlw8012
sel_pin:
number: GPIO12
inverted: True
cf_pin: GPIO4
cf1_pin: GPIO5
voltage_divider: 780
current:
name: "${friendly_name} Current"
icon: mdi:lightning-bolt-circle
filters:
- calibrate_linear:
- 0.0000 -> 0.0110 # Relay off no load
- 0.0097 -> 0.0260 # Relay on no load
- 0.9270 -> 0.7570
- 2.0133 -> 1.6330
- 2.9307 -> 2.3750
- 5.4848 -> 4.4210
- 8.4308 -> 6.8330
- 9.9171 -> 7.9830
# Normalize for plug load
- lambda: if (x < 0.0260) return 0; else return (x - 0.0260);
voltage:
name: "${friendly_name} Voltage"
icon: mdi:lightning-bolt-circle
power:
name: "${friendly_name} Power"
icon: mdi:lightning-bolt-circle
id: socket_my_power
unit_of_measurement: W
filters:
- calibrate_linear:
- 0.0000 -> 0.5900 # Relay off no load
- 0.0000 -> 1.5600 # Relay on no load
- 198.5129 -> 87.8300
- 434.2469 -> 189.5000
- 628.6241 -> 273.9000
- 1067.0067 -> 460.1000
- 1619.8098 -> 699.2000
- 2043.0282 -> 885.0000
# Normalize for plug load
- lambda: if (x < 1.5600) return 0; else return (x - 1.5600);
change_mode_every: 1
update_interval: 10s
- platform: total_daily_energy
name: "${friendly_name} Total Energy"
icon: mdi:clock-alert
power_id: socket_my_power
unit_of_measurement: kWh
accuracy_decimals: 3
restore: true
filters:
- multiply: 0.001
- platform: wifi_signal
name: "${friendly_name} Wifi Signal"
update_interval: 60s
button:
- platform: factory_reset
name: Restart with Factory Default Settings
id: Reset
switch:
- platform: gpio
name: "${friendly_name}"
icon: mdi:power-socket-us
pin: GPIO14
id: relay
restore_mode: ${relay_restore_mode}
on_turn_on:
- light.turn_on: blue_led
on_turn_off:
- light.turn_off: blue_led
light:
- platform: status_led
name: "${friendly_name} Status LED"
icon: mdi:led-outline
id: blue_led
disabled_by_default: true
pin:
inverted: true
number: GPIO13
text_sensor:
- platform: wifi_info
ip_address:
name: "${friendly_name} IP Address"
disabled_by_default: true
